Maryland Eastern Shore men’s golf finishes ninth at Battle at Rum Pointe

The University of Maryland Eastern Shore men’s golf team finished ninth out of sixteen teams in the Battle at Rum Pointe, according to a March 30 announcement. The event took place in Berlin, Maryland, where the Hawks recorded a team score of 609 over two rounds.

The team’s top performer was Max Osten, who tied for fifteenth place with scores of 73 and 75 for a total of 148. Andreas Roman followed closely behind, tying for twenty-first with rounds of 73 and 76 for a combined score of 149. Jeter Teng finished tied for forty-fourth with scores of 78 and 75 (153 total), while Marcos Ramirez placed seventy-eighth after shooting an eighty and seventy-nine (159 total). Jaden Hansen rounded out the team’s scoring in ninety-fifth place with rounds of eighty-four and eighty-three (167 total).

The tournament provided valuable experience for the Hawks as they competed against a strong field. Their performance highlighted both individual achievements and areas to build upon as they continue their season.

Looking ahead, Maryland Eastern Shore will return to competition on April 6-7 at the Appalachian State Irish Creek Intercollegiate in Kannapolis, North Carolina.
